There are few riders over our sport’s deep history that evoke the same emotion and respect from fans as Bob "Hurricane" Hannah. His straightforward approach on and off the track had his legion of fans dedicated to the legend in the making on his ascent to the top. One of the defining races in his storied career was undoubtably the 1981 Massacre at Saddleback where he and Kent Howerton were part of one of the most controversial races of all time. For the first time ever, fans can relive the dramatic race on the newly released film on DVD Massacre at Saddleback where never before seen footage from the race can be seen with Hannah himself adding color commentary. Todd Huffman from The Motocross Files lends his genius eye to this stunning film that is sure to be an instant classic. You can get your copy now at www.HannahRacingProducts.com or www.Motocrossfiles.com and check out the trailer on YouTube.
 
Yamaha’s Racing Division Manager Keith McCarty was also there throughout Hannah’s career and actually captured the epic footage from Saddleback on his own video camera for all motocross fans to now enjoy. Keith will join us as well and add his insight to all the good stuff that never made the magazines about this race and a great deal more.
 
Rockstar Makita Factory Suzuki’s Mike Alessi is arguably one of the top favorites for an outdoor title going into this season after his impressive speed and results last year prior to the injury. A solid performance at Glen Helen netted a second OA, but you could tell Mike wanted more. We will check in with him after he had a few days to reflect on the opening round.
 
The supercross season has mercifully ended for Joe Gibbs Racing’s Cody Cooper and the likeable New Zealander looks to do some damage on the track outdoors instead of the other way around. Cody had a solid ride at Glen Helen and is obviously back in his element and will rejoice with us this evening.
 
I have been bombarded with emails to get Troy Lee Design’s David Pingree back on the show and we aim to please here at DMXS. The voluptuous Pingree will indeed make an appearance during tonight’s festivities as the fans have commanded.
 
Kevin Kelly is simply living on borrowed time. His constant mockery of Trey Canard’s Hulk-like trainer Greg DiRenzo is bound to end badly for the smart mouthed Georgian. I have invited Greg on the show to respond to Kevin’s taunts and hopefully some details on when he will violently apply the much deserved retribution.
